The Epicenter: Women’s Global Sports Summit
In August 2026, Shelly-Ann Fraser-Pryce joined leaders across the global sports industry at The Epicenter: Women’s Global Sports Summit, presented by Nike in Portland, Oregon. She participated in the panel, “Built for Her: Rewriting Human Performance,” exploring how women-centered research, health, performance science and investment are reshaping the future of sport.
Drawing on her 18-year career at the highest level of professional athletics, Shelly-Ann shared her perspective on challenging long-held assumptions around women, motherhood and athletic longevity, as well as the importance of equipping the next generation with greater access to knowledge, resources and opportunity.
A central theme of her remarks was the need to “invest globally and invest earlier.” Shelly-Ann spoke about the power of sports diplomacy and the opportunity for brands, investors and sports leaders to look beyond established markets and invest in the ecosystems that allow female talent to develop—from grassroots programming and coaching to education, sports science, nutrition and professional pathways.
Reflecting on her own journey from Jamaica to the global stage, she challenged industry leaders to consider women’s sports not simply as a growing commercial market, but as a global movement capable of connecting cultures, strengthening communities and expanding who has the opportunity to become the next generation of champions.
